NOC Engineer | £25,000 - £32,000 + Bonus | Hybrid | MSP


Our client is looking for a NOC Engineer to join a growing Managed Services team, providing first-line technical support to a diverse client base across enterprise networking environments.


This is an excellent opportunity for someone with a solid foundation in IT support and networking who enjoys troubleshooting, solving problems, and developing their technical skills within a collaborative and supportive team.


What You'll Be Doing


As the first point of contact for customers, you'll play a key role in ensuring incidents and service requests are handled professionally, efficiently, and within agreed service levels.

Your responsibilities will include:


  • Acting as the first point of contact for technical incidents and service requests via phone, email, customer portal and monitoring systems.
  • Logging, prioritising and managing support tickets through the ITSM platform.
  • Troubleshooting connectivity, hardware and software issues, resolving incidents where possible at first contact.
  • Escalating more complex issues to 2nd Line Support with clear and accurate documentation.
  • Keeping customers informed throughout the lifecycle of incidents with regular updates.
  • Monitoring customer environments proactively, responding to alerts before they become major issues.
  • Carrying out routine maintenance, health checks, updates and patching activities.
  • Maintaining accurate documentation and contributing to the internal knowledge base.
  • Following security best practices and identifying potential security or compliance concerns.


What We're Looking For


You'll ideally have

  • Previous experience in a 1st Line Support, Service Desk or Helpdesk role.
  • A good understanding of networking fundamentals including routing, switching and connectivity troubleshooting.
  • Experience using ITSM/ticketing systems in an SLA-driven environment.
  • Strong customer service and communication skills.
  • Excellent troubleshooting and analytical abilities.
  • The ability to manage multiple priorities while maintaining attention to detail.
  • A proactive, team-focused approach with a genuine desire to deliver outstanding customer service.
  • A networking qualification such as CCNA, JNCIA, CompTIA Network+ (or be actively working towards one).


Desirable Experience

  • ITIL Foundation (or awareness of ITIL principles).
  • Experience working within a Managed Service Provider (MSP) environment.
  • Exposure to enterprise networking technologies including Cisco, Juniper, Palo Alto or Fortinet.
  • Experience with network monitoring and proactive support tools.
